The Adventures of Tintin, a beloved comic book series created by Belgian cartoonist Georges Remi, alias Hergé, has been entertaining readers worldwide for generations. One of the most popular installments in the series is "Tintin in America," which follows the adventures of Tintin, a young Belgian reporter, and his loyal canine companion Snowy as they travel to the United States.
